It’s summer and prime time for wedding celebrations! This pretty centerpiece will add a festive note to your celebration. Made from a giant glass champagne flute, it features dangling flower blossom strings reminiscent of falling cherry petals and rising champagne bubbles. And it’s so easy to make!
